Abstract
First observations of the Bs0âÏ(2S)η, B0âÏ(2S)Ï+Ïâ and Bs0âÏ(2S)Ï+Ïâ decays are made using a dataset corresponding to an integrated luminosity of 1.0 fbâ1 collected by the LHCb experiment in proton-proton collisions at a centre-of-mass energy of s=7 TeV.
